DescriptionLeidos is seeking a summer intern with a Computer Science background to join our team in support of the SMIT contract, the largest IT services program for the Navy. Under the Service Management, Integration, and Transport (SMIT), Leidos team will deliver the core backbone of the Navy-Marine Corps Intranet (NMCI), including cybersecurity services, network operations, service desk, and data transport. Ultimately, the Leidos team will support the Navy in unifying its shore-based networks and data management to improve capability and service while also saving significant dollars by focusing efforts under one enterprise network.
